Hi..New to group and to Multiplas and have a question..i own a 2008 fiat multipla 1.9 jtd and my tailgate, which opened and closed up till yesterday now refuses to open..
Can anyone tell me what the problem could be and how to solve it..Thanks in anticipation ..
 
Probably a gummed up microswitch in the bootlid, under the rubber cover that you press to open the tailgate. Use the advanced forum Search button at the top of the page, using “microswitch” as the search term and with the search focus narrowed down to the Multipla section (from the list at bottom right). You’ll get lots of results and in there somewhere will be one or two How-To’s on fixing it. Some have used a microswitch from a Vauxhall (Cavalier?) to effect a repair.

As it's a 2008 model, it will be a facelift one, so sadly no release lever by drivers seat/handbrake.
If you cannot get the door open from outside, there is a lever in the boot door itself, but you will need to remove a rear seat, and look closely at the lock on tailgate, a small screwdriver can be used to 'flick' the little lever. Will try to take a pic and post later..
(If you have a manual, check page 79, as this shows the location of the switch)
